Knicks vs. Magic Game Info

  • Date: Friday, March 8, 2024
  • Time: 7:30 PM ET
  • Venue: Madison Square Garden -- New York City, New York
  • Coverage: MSG and BSFL

The Orlando Magic (37-26) are favored (-1.5) to extend a five-game win streak when they visit the New York Knicks (35-27) at 7:30 PM ET on Friday, March 8, 2024 at Madison Square Garden. The contest airs on MSG and BSFL. The over/under for the matchup is set at 205.5.

Knicks vs. Magic Betting Trends

  • The Magic are 42-21-0 against the spread this season.
  • The Knicks are 32-28-1 against the spread this season.
  • Magic games have gone over the total 29 times out of 61 chances this season.
  • The Knicks have hit the over 39.3% of the time this year (24 of 61 games with a set point total).
  • Orlando sports a better record against the spread in home games (21-8-0) than it does on the road (21-13-0).
  • When it comes to over/unders, the Magic hit the over less consistently at home, as they've gone over the total 13 times in 29 opportunities this season (44.8%). On the road, they have hit the over 16 times in 34 opportunities (47.1%).
  • New York's winning percentage against the spread at home is .484 (15-15-1). Away, it is .567 (17-13-0).
  • Knicks games have gone above the over/under less often at home (11 times out of 31) than away (13 of 30) this year.

Magic Leaders

  • Paolo Banchero's numbers on the season are 22.9 points, 6.8 boards and 5.2 assists per game, shooting 46.2% from the field and 36.2% from beyond the arc, with an average of 1.5 made treys.
  • Franz Wagner averages 20.4 points, 5.5 boards and 4 assists.
  • Cole Anthony's numbers on the season are 11.8 points, 4 rebounds and 3 assists per contest, shooting 43.2% from the floor and 31.9% from beyond the arc, with an average of 1 made treys.
  • Jalen Suggs is averaging 12.2 points, 3.3 boards and 2.6 assists.
  • Moritz Wagner is averaging 11.3 points, 4.6 rebounds and 1.2 assists. Defensively, he averages 0.5 steals and 0.3 blocked shots.

Knicks Leaders

  • Jalen Brunson averages 27.1 points, 3.7 rebounds and 6.5 assists. He is also draining 47.8% of his shots from the floor and 41.1% from beyond the arc, with 2.6 triples per game.
  • Per game, Donte DiVincenzo gets the Knicks 14.2 points, 3.4 rebounds and 2.5 assists. He also averages 1.2 steals and 0.4 blocks.
  • The Knicks receive 8.5 points per game from Josh Hart, plus 7.6 boards and 3.5 assists.
  • Per game, Isaiah Hartenstein gives the Knicks 6.9 points, 8.4 rebounds and 2.1 assists, plus 1.1 steals and 1.1 blocks.
  • Alec Burks averages 12.4 points, 2.5 boards and 1.6 assists. He is sinking 39.3% of his shots from the field and 40% from beyond the arc, with 2.3 treys per contest.
